Significado
Asking about someone's current activity.
Contexto cultural
Norwegians are direct. This question is not seen as prying, but as friendly interest. Similar to 'What are you up to?', it is a standard way to start a conversation. Very similar cultural approach to directness and activity-based questions. Asking 'What are you doing?' can be seen as intrusive if not close to the person.
Silent H
Remember that the 'h' in 'hva' is always silent. Don't pronounce it!
V2 Rule
Always keep the verb in the second position. It's the golden rule of Norwegian questions.
